Author: Gary P.
This place rocks it as far as I am concerned. Food is interesting, fun, well presented and tasty. Hi vibe atmosphere, energy, excitement abound. Go with confidence, but make a reservation, they are busy!

Author: Vivian R.
What a great experience! We came here for brunch and it wasn't busy at all. We requested to sit outside to enjoy the beautiful weather, and the outside area is absolutely gorgeous with a ton of shade. The food was delicious. We ordered the chilequiles, smoked pork shoulder hash, and the ultimate sticky bun. Everything was so good! The ultimate sticky bun is like a cinnamon roll. It was so sweet, and we weren't able to finish, but still amazing! Our server was kind and prompt with service. We'll definitely be back for a date night!

Author: justin j.
Giving this place 5 stars...but HEAR me out. Most of the menu is very small, almost tapas sized portions and they are quite expensive. However, when I tell you the food was DELECTABLE....I tell no lies. We were with a big group so it was easy to pass around, share, and try different items. I think we ordered almost half the menu which made this an amazing dining experience. Advice: Go with a large group, bring your pennies. Fav items: -Glazed brisket was probably some of the best I've ever had -Everybody enjoyed the Oak potatoes -Hush puppies are a must, /drool Stay away -Crab fried rice not worth the price..at all

Author: Tanya K.
We had a dinner here as well as Saturday brunch. Both times we had a great experience - friendly service. The space is clean & airy. All the food was amazing! For dinner we had little gem salad, unique & tasy cucumber salad, octopus fritters, shrimp & sausage andouille, braised oxtail raviolini. Every dish was very flavorful and the bread is amazing! This morning brunch was wonderful - we had smoked salmon toast, egg white scramble & sticky bun. All were delicious & beautifully presented.
